We are looking for a Senior CI/CD Engineer to become a critical part of our global software team. The Senior CI/CD Engineer will primarily focus on creating reusable pipeline templates, enhancing the efficiency of our development process, and ensuring high standards of quality and reliability. The successful candidate must have a solid understanding of development infrastructure, CI/CD tools, and software development lifecycle (SDLC).
Our mission is to shape a world with a significantly reduced number of road accidents, fatalities, and injuries.
You will
- Design, build, and maintain reusable and efficient pipeline templates for various applications across different platforms
- Improve our CI/CD tooling and processes and provide tooling adoption guidance and best practices
- Collaborate with development teams to identify and analyze the bottlenecks in the existing pipeline and create solutions to streamline and automate them
- Provide guidance and support to development teams for implementing CI/CD pipelines into their development process
- Continuously evaluate existing systems with industry standards, and make recommendations for enhancement and optimization
- Provide technical guidance and educate team members and coworkers on development and operations
- Document and design various processes; update existing processes
